✨ Features
Core platform
One command, persistent — a dual-face dsh.bundle + dsh.client package:
dsh plugin add once, and the tool, the preview route, the prompt section and the
Design Studio tab are all present on every launch. No build step, no TypeScript,
zero runtime dependencies (plain JavaScript).
design_studio agent tool — your assistant (and any subagent) can
list / all / create / read / write / zip / reveal / delete / sweep design systems,
manage identity presets, run vision reviews, chat with the design agent, read its
history, and configure the studio — all scoped to temp_design_folder/ design folders.
Live preview route — /design-studio//html/index.html, served by the
harness web server; the studio tab embeds it in an iframe with hot reload on save.
Design-brief routing — a system-prompt section turns operator screen briefs into
design systems automatically.
Design systems
Mockup-scoped files — every design system is html/index.html,
css/style.css, css/token.css, js/app.js (minimal presentation) plus
design_prompts_forcoders.md (the brief the coding agent follows) and
assets/images/ for uploads. Mock data stays honest — empty/loading states,
never fabricated live numbers.
Per-conversation ownership — each design system is bound to the conversation
that created it; the tab shows only your chat's designs (unbound legacy systems
are adopted on first list).
Drop zones — drop images or code files onto the tab; images land in
assets/images/ and auto-select in the agent chat picker.
Zip export + Finder reveal + delete — _zips/.zip (files only), open -R,
and shell-free recursive delete that works even on hosts with no POSIX shell.
Design agent (real harness subagent)
It does the work itself — the agent chat runs a harness subagent (spawn
engine, design-studio persona) that lists, reads and edits the design files across
multiple tool calls per message, then summarizes file-level changes.
Live activity — its reads/edits stream into the chat as they happen, with
inline errors, a persisted per-system history, and run timeouts.
Vision pre-pass — images explicitly selected in the picker (or mentioned by
filename) are pre-described by your configured vision model, so "the image"
always means the right one and the agent never guesses between assets.
Design-cache discipline — on every turn (even a bare "ok") the agent verifies
the freshness stamp, reports whether the design changed since its last turn,
adopts the latest files as truth, and asks what you want when the request is vague.
🎯 Element picker + two-agent apply flow
Click 🎯 Select, click any element in the live preview, describe the change:
Button
What happens
🤖 Ask DeepSeek(default)
Saves EDIT_REQUEST.md, injects the request into your main chat. DeepSeek edits the files itself and invokes the design agent only when it needs vision (the tool routes it explicitly). A live run banner tracks queued → working → finished in the tab, and the studio auto-runs a design-agent verification once the edits settle — guaranteed designer involvement, not a hope.
◈ Make the design agent do it
The classic flow: the design agent applies the change itself and replies in its chat.
💾 Save only
Just writes EDIT_REQUEST.md — apply later from either chat.
Freshness stamps (multi-agent safety)
Every design change bumps a stamp {hash, at} (fresh random hash + ISO time,
latest-status only) — the plugin detects changes from any editor via the
harness fs/observed stream, plus synchronous bumps on its own write paths.
Agents compare their remembered hash with the current one: drift ("changed since
your last turn") is surfaced in prompts and tool output, and the design agent
records a per-turn design cache so the next turn can prove UNCHANGED/CHANGED.
Vision, screenshots & presets
📸 Shot — capture a screen region (screencapture on macOS) straight into the
design system's assets/images/.
👁 Review — honest GOOD | POOR verdict + one-sentence notes from your
OpenRouter vision model against the brief (configurable models, effort, options).
Identity presets — save palettes/typography/logos as presets; preset_apply
writes css/token.css and copies logo assets. Credentials are handled through the
harness credential seam (OPENROUTER_API_KEY) — the key is never rendered or returned.
Settings & data
Settings → Design Studio / All designs pages: config, key status, system list,
zip/reveal/delete per design.
Everything survives restarts — designs, presets, config, reviews and agent
history live on disk under temp_design_folder/.
Quick start
Works with both harness distributions — the npm distribution
(npx @deepseek-ai/dsh web) and a source checkout (pnpm dsh web).
# 1. start the harness (if not running): npx @deepseek-ai/dsh web
# 2. install the plugin
dsh plugin --profile web add "github:sal7two/dsh-design-studio#main"
# 3. restart the harness so the new layers load
From a local checkout:
dsh plugin --profile web add -w /absolute/path/to/dsh-design-studio
-w is only needed when your profile directory is a pnpm workspace root
(pnpm-workspace.yaml with packages: [., packages/*]), and the path must be
absolute — a bare relative path is misread as a GitHub owner/repo shorthand.
Remove with the package name:
dsh plugin --profile web remove @sal7one/dsh-design-studio.
The bundle row is enabled by default. To keep it installed but off, override it in
your profile's own cordis.patch.yml (profile layers apply after bundle layers and win
per row):
- id: dsh-design-studio
disabled: true
Optional: in the tab → Settings → Design Studio, paste an OpenRouter API key to enable
vision review and image description (stored via the credential seam; never shown again).
Everything else works without it.

Workflows
Iterate with the design agent. Open the Design Studio tab → select your design →
type a request in the agent chat ("make the status bar left-aligned", "use this image
as the background"). It reads, edits and summarizes; the preview reloads.
Pick an element and let DeepSeek change it. 🎯 Select → click the element → type
the change → 🤖 Ask DeepSeek. The request appears in your main chat, DeepSeek
edits, the tab banner tracks progress, and the design agent auto-verifies the result.
Give DeepSeek a visual job. Drop a palette image on the tab (it lands in
assets/images/), then in the main chat:
In the tic-tac-toe design, read the color palette from assets/images/palette.png
and apply it to css/token.css. Use the design agent for the visual read.
DeepSeek routes the vision work to the design agent (design_studio → agent), the
image is auto-attached and vision-described, and the result flows back into DeepSeek's
tool result.
Requirements
Node ≥ 22 and the harness (npm distribution ≥ 0.1.0-rc.5, or a source checkout of
the same generation) with the standard host services
(fs, subprocess, webServer, llm, credentials, attachments, systemPrompt, tools).
The design tree root must exist at the server process workspace root as
temp_design_folder/ (a symlink is fine).
For vision review: an OpenRouter key stored under credential reference
OPENROUTER_API_KEY, or a harness openrouter provider route.
⚠️ Compatibility notes — mistakes we already made so you don't have to
This plugin was built and broken against a moving harness base. The traps:
shell is gone at host level. The old shell executor (resolve/run) now lives
in session presets. A host row that injects shellwaits forever silently —
no boot error, no route, no tool. Inject subprocess and build shell semantics
yourself (see lib/index.js → sh()).
Hard-inject everything you register against.apply() runs as soon as its
injections resolve, which can be beforewebServer/tools/llm exist. A one-time
ctx.get() taken too early returns undefined and silently skips the route/tool/
section registration. Put integration points in inject so apply waits.
Provider keys collide with the built-in catalog. The base ships llm-pi-ai,
which natively declares openrouter (among others). Registering your own
openrouter configurable provider throws DUPLICATE_DIRECTORY and kills the whole
web boot. Check the target base's catalog before releasing a provider plugin.
Commit lib/. A harness checkout's .gitignore ignores lib/ — a plugin
committed inside one ships without its entry point. This repo lives at its own top
level and ships plain JS, so lib/index.js is committed.
Dynamic plugins die on restart. Everything in dynamic/ is in-memory by design.
The bundle is the restart-safe part. Don't promise users a persistent tab from a
dynamic package.
Client services are scope-addressed. The main chat is reachable from another
tab via sessions.scope(sessionId).get('conversation') — property access
(scoped.conversation) does not resolve the service. (This exact bug shipped
once; the fix is in lib/client.js → askDeepSeek.)
